Q: Is 176,307,117 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 176,307,117 is a composite number.

Why is 176,307,117 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 176,307,117 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 2,287 3,671 6,861 11,013 16,009 25,697 48,027 77,091 8,395,577 25,186,731 58,769,039 and 176,307,117, with no remainder.

Since 176,307,117 cannot be divided by just 1 and 176,307,117, it is a composite number.
